2 Vík í MyrdalVík, nestled on the southern shores of Iceland, is a picturesque village by the sea, famous for its extraordinary landscapes. Its unique black sand beaches and dramatic rock structures add to its charm. Key attractions include the stunning Reynisfjara Beach, surrounded by basalt columns and the Reynisdrangar sea stacks. With a cozy community of around 300 people, Vík is an ideal tranquil retreat, offering a genuine slice of Icelandic life. Activities like strolling through the village, discovering the nearby cliffs, or horse riding along the shoreline make Vík a captivating destination that truly showcases Iceland’s natural wonders.

4 Skógafoss WaterfallSkógafoss waterfall, nestled in the heart of southern Iceland along the Skógá River, stands as a breathtaking spectacle. Cascading majestically from towering cliffs, this waterfall plunges a staggering 60 meters, creating a resounding and mist-shrouded panorama, often adorned with vibrant rainbows. The vicinity surrounding Skógafoss exudes lush, verdant beauty, and its sheer power and aesthetic charm are nothing short of captivating.
For the adventurous souls, a stairway adjacent to the falls offers an opportunity to ascend and relish a stunning aerial perspective. Alternatively, those seeking tranquility can simply bask in the mesmerizing view from the riverbank. Skógafoss is an iconic gem of Iceland, a testament to the untamed and resplendent natural wonders that grace this extraordinary country.

5 Seljalandsfoss WaterfallSeljalandsfoss waterfall, a distinctive gem within Iceland’s natural tapestry, is renowned for its breathtaking beauty. What sets it apart is the rare and exhilarating opportunity it presents: the chance to walk behind the cascading curtain of water, an experience seldom found elsewhere. Fed by the Seljalandsá River, the waterfall descends from lofty cliffs, orchestrating a mesmerizing symphony of sound and light.
The surroundings of Seljalandsfoss are adorned in lush, verdant splendor, creating an idyllic backdrop that beckons photographers and nature enthusiasts alike. A visit to this ethereal waterfall fosters an intimate connection with the untamed, awe-inspiring landscapes that define the essence of Iceland.
